    Unlike LLMs, we can’t scrape the internet for robot data. Announcing Project Go-Big: we’re building the world's largest humanoid pretraining dataset. This is accelerated by our partnership with Brookfield, who owns over 100,000 residential units. Helix is now learning directly from human video data. We have already trained on data collected in the real world, including Brookfield residential units. To our knowledge, this is the first instance of a humanoid robot learning navigation end-to-end using only human video. Every machine learning breakthrough has come from massive, diverse datasets. There is nothing like this for robotics so we are building our own. A single Helix neural network now outputs both manipulation and navigation, end-to-end from language and pixel input.     Today we unveiled the first humanoid robot that can fold laundry autonomously. The same Helix architecture that solved logistics tasks was applied directly to laundry folding. There were no modifications to the model or training hyperparameters - the only addition was the dataset. We're also expanding our natural multimodal human interaction. Helix learned to maintain eye contact, direct its gaze, and use learned hand gestures while engaging with people. Today we posted a short write-up on the website.     Today we're introducing our next generation humanoid battery for F.03. The F.03 battery is a significant advancement in our core humanoid robot technology roadmap and was engineered in-house and manufactured at BotQ. Advancements across 3 generations of battery technology has resulted in: → 78% reduction in cost → Higher safety and reliability → 2kW fast charge with active cooling → Significant energy density improvements The F.03 battery employs a number of novel design strategies including: → Structural Battery: our structural battery pack features a high-strength enclosure made of stamped steel, die-cast aluminum, and structural adhesives. This enables it to withstand a 1-meter drop onto concrete from any angle. → Active Cooling System: we created an active cooling system with integrated cooling components in the die casting. This reduces thermal resistance and local heat, allowing fast charging with basic forced convection cooling. → Anti-Propagation & Flame Containment System: the pack includes safety measures to stop thermal runaway from spreading to nearby cells and to contain flames. This is achieved using a thermally insulative potting compound and rapid heat distribution. Today, we're sharing a detailed write-up of the F.03 battery development process.     Today we're showing Helix's neural network do 60 minutes of uninterrupted logistics work. In the last few months, we've advanced our Helix neural network, which in Logistics is now capable of: → New package types → 20% faster package handling → 35% higher barcode scanning success → Adaptive behaviors such as patting down packages Many of the gains shown here were enabled by improvements to Helix’s System 1 policy. Helix now incorporates upgrades in temporal memory and force feedback. For example: the robot can now feel when it first touches an object. In addition to model improvements, we also saw strong gains from scaling training data. As we scaled from 10 to 60 hours of training data we saw the time/package drop from 6.3 to 4.3 seconds and barcode scanning accuracy improve from 88% to ~95%.
